Program Director - Early Head Start BASE WAGE $64,712.36 - $74,382.03 annually based on experience and education level. JOB TYPE Full-Time DESCRIPTION Early Head Start Child Care Partnerships, part of SAL Community Services, is the Quad Cities areas leading provider of early childhood care and education.
